Case Based Critical ThinkingMark is a well-known illustrator and artist who started his own design firm two years ago. Because Mark's business is more about illustration than anything else, he is constantly challenging his staff to hone their skills in Adobe Illustrator. He finds that, though many have "played around" with the software, most of his designers are Photoshop gurus who don't fully appreciate the abilities and the concepts associated with Illustrator.

Mark's team is excited to be working on a project that involves many geometric illustrations, but the big challenge is that the artwork demands precise positioning. In many cases, objects must abut precisely, with no gap and no overlap. Mark tells his team that they should rely heavily on which of the following Illustrator features?

A. grouping objects
B. smart guides
C. dragging and dropping
D. drawing marquees


Answer: B
